"I Totally Funniest: A Middle School Story" follows the adventures of Rafe Khatchadorian, a creative young boy who aspires to be a stand-up comedian. He navigates the challenges of middle school while grappling with the pressures of fitting in and pursuing his passion for comedy. With his unique perspective on life and humor, Rafe tries to make a name for himself in the competitive world of school performances.
Throughout the story, Rafe encounters various characters and situations that showcase both the hilarity and difficulties of growing up. He forms friendships and faces rivalries, all while learning important lessons about self-acceptance and perseverance. The narrative highlights the importance of kindness and staying true to oneself even in the face of adversity.
Rafe's journey is both entertaining and relatable, offering a blend of humor and heartfelt moments. As he strives to prove himself as the funniest kid in school, readers are drawn into his comedic mishaps and triumphs, making it a fun read for those who appreciate middle school humor and the struggles of adolescence.
